In addition to the 44 German-made tanks heading to Lithuania, the Czech Republic is acquiring another batch of 44 Leopard 2A8 MBT main battle tanks.

Earlier this month, the Lithuanian government announced its intention to speed up the procurement process for the German-made Leopard 2A8 MBT. The goal is to receive all 44 improved versions of this widely used tank [in the armed forces of several states] by 2030.

The purchase of the Leopards will allow the formation of a new division with an armored battalion in the Lithuanian ground forces. Previously, this Baltic country had only minimal armored forces.

"The principle of collective defense is our main pillar, and Lithuania's main contribution to it is a mechanized division that meets NATO standards. Tanks are the backbone of this type of unit. The process of their integration into the armed forces system takes a very long time, so no delays should be allowed," said Lithuanian Defense Minister Dovile Shakalene.

Vilnius has promised to increase the limit on the allocation of loans for defense purposes for the purchase of modern MBT. The country's spending is expected to reach about 4% of GDP by the end of 2025. The Lithuanian leadership has also promised to increase defense spending to 5.2% of GDP in 2026.

Technical characteristics of the Leopard 2A8 tank

Year of production: introduced in 2023, the start of operation is scheduled for 2027.

Quantity: not disclosed.

Length: 9.97 meters.

Total weight in combat condition: from 65 to 67 tons.

Suspension: reinforced torsion bar.

Engine: 1,500 hp diesel engine, potentially with an improved cooling system and upgraded to achieve higher performance.

Armament: 120 mm smoothbore cannon, probably a version of the L55 A1.

Maximum speed: up to 65-70 km/h on roads.

Power reserve: approximately 400-450 kilometers without refueling.

Crew: four people.

About the Leopard 2A8 tank

Leopard 2A8 is the latest modification of the German—made MBT, which first entered service in October 1979. The new model, produced by Krauss-Maffei Wegmann based on the Leopard 2A7+, features several notable improvements, including the Trophy active protection system and an improved 360-degree all-round viewing system. The upgraded version is equipped with the latest generation of passive multilayer composite modular armor, consisting of steel, tungsten, composite filler and ceramics.

The Model 28A is equipped with a three-person turret, which houses the main 120 mm smoothbore L55 cannon manufactured by Rheinmetall, an upgraded version of the L44 cannon, which was installed on previous Leopard 2 models. It is reported that the L55 is approximately 1.3 meters longer, which provides a higher muzzle velocity, as well as greater accuracy, range and penetration.. The advanced cannon can fire a variety of ammunition, including APFSDS (armor-piercing projectile with ribbed stabilization), thermal (anti-tank high explosive shells) and multipurpose ammunition.

The overall layout of the upgraded tank is similar to other models. It is equipped with an advanced 1600 hp engine, which allows the Leopard 2A8 to reach speeds of over 70 km/h.

German tank troops are also present in Lithuania.

A fleet of 44 MBTs, even as powerful as the Leopard 2A8, is unlikely to be enough to stop a full-scale Russian invasion. To further protect NATO's eastern flank in the Baltic States, the German military began deploying an armored brigade of 5,000 people in Lithuania, equipped with an additional 105 Leopards in a new modification.

This move by Berlin represents the first time that German military personnel have been permanently deployed on foreign territory since the end of World War II. The deployment of the contingent is part of a strategy to reorient Germany towards national defense, caused by the start of Russia's special operation in Ukraine in 2022 and recent concerns about the reliability of the United States as a security guarantor in the event of a conflict between Russia and NATO.

The Bundeswehr said that the 45th armored brigade will be fully operational by 2027.

The new Leopard 2A8 will also arrive in Central Europe.

In addition to the 44 tanks that will go to Lithuania, the Czech Republic will purchase another batch of 44 Leopards. The government of this NATO-affiliated Central European country said it had approved the purchase of tanks as part of a deal worth 32.76 billion Czech crowns ($1.56 billion). A separate contract worth 1.49 billion crowns ($71 million) was signed for the maintenance of the machines.

Prague also noted the possibility of purchasing an additional 14 cars. According to a report published in the Defense Post, the Czech Republic "will receive from 61 to 77 Leopard 2A8 tanks in six modifications," 19 of which will include "engineering, repair, bridge and training models for drivers."

The Czech army is replacing the last Soviet-era tanks that were sent as aid to Ukraine and is modernizing its armored forces. Earlier, a total of 86 T-72M1 tanks were delivered to Kiev.

"Tanks still occupy an indisputable place on the modern battlefield and are an integral part of the modern army," said Karel Rzecha, Chief of the General Staff of the Czech Armed Forces. "The quality of the Leopard 2A8 tank — from firepower to crew protection capability and technological sophistication — ensures that the Czech Army receives a first—class means of ensuring national defense."
